Orange Beach, Alabama

Something magical happens when you visit Orange Beach on the Alabama Gulf Coast. The moment you arrive, the world starts to fade away. Maybe it's the sound of waves gently lapping the shore or the smell of coconut oil. Perhaps it's the white sand beach and sparkling emerald water. Suddenly building sandcastles moves to the top of the "to-do" list. This, and more, awaits the visitor to this seaside town.

No matter how long a visit, there is plenty to occupy every hour of the day. Putter around a bit on one of the championship golf courses or cast a line for deep-sea adventure on a charter fishing trip. Travel back in history with a visit to Fort Morgan, the site of the Civil War Battle of Mobile Bay. Visitors can even commune with Mother Nature as they hike through one of the many wildlife areas and gaze at gators and shorebirds in the process.

The Gulf coast area has a mild climate with an average annual temperature of 67.4 degrees. The average annual precipitation is 67 inches, and the growing season is 292 days. The beaches are pleasant for sunning and walking year round. Water sports begin in the spring and are at their peak in summer and early fall.
